    R15

    Readings and indexes of profiled C5 customers. Used to publish the monthly readings of every customer inside a supplier's perimeter, so a file usually carries many PRM — one source per PRM has to exist.

    Insights configuration

    Property Value
    Meter number of the source Id_PRM of the PRM block
    Mapping config of the variable See below

    See Source configuration for the other properties.

    Mapping config

    R15_Classe_Temporelle_{Id_Classe_Temporelle}_Classe-{Classe_Mesure}_{nature}
    
    Segment Description Values
    {Id_Classe_Temporelle} Time class of the index or the measurement BASE, HP, HC, HPH, HCH, HPE, HCE, … as published
    {Classe_Mesure} What the value is 1: index
    2: consumption
    {nature} Nature of the value REEL, ESTIME, REGULARISE, AUTO-RELEVE

    The nature is not read from the same element for both classes:

    Class Nature read from
    Classe-1 (index) Nature_Index
    Classe-2 (consumption) Nature_Consommation

    Example

    R15_Classe_Temporelle_BASE_Classe-2_REEL
    

    Data point

    Timestamp Date_Releve of the reading. The value carries its offset and is stored in UTC.
    Value Valeur of the time class

    One reading produces one data point per time class it contains.

    What is not stored

    • A reading whose Statut_Releve is neither INITIAL nor RECTIFICATIF — a cancelled reading (ANNULE) is ignored, and does not remove the point it cancels.
    • A reading without Date_Releve.
